메뉴 건너뛰기




Volumn 15, Issue 3, 2010, Pages

Concept-based partitioning for large multidomain multifunctional embedded systems

Author keywords

Codesign; Embedded system design; Product families; System evolution; System partitioning; UML

Indexed keywords

CO-DESIGNS; COMPONENT INTEGRATION; COMPONENT-BASED DEVELOPMENT; COMPOSABILITY; CONCEPT-BASED; CONFIGURABLE; EMBEDDED SYSTEM DESIGN; EXECUTABLE SPECIFICATIONS; FEATURE VARIATIONS; FINE GRANULARITY; HARDWARE SOFTWARE PARTITIONING; HIGH LEVEL SPECIFICATION; INDUSTRIAL PRODUCT; MULTI DOMAINS; NEW APPROACHES; NEW MEMBERS; NEW PRODUCT; PRODUCT-LINES; SEQUENCE DIAGRAMS; SYSTEM EVOLUTION; SYSTEM SPECIFICATION; UML 2.0;

EID: 77953582614     PISSN: 10844309     EISSN: 15577309     Source Type: Journal    
DOI: 10.1145/1754405.1754407     Document Type: Article
Times cited : (6)

References (82)
  • 8
    • 85008018442 scopus 로고    scopus 로고
    • Better software through operational dynamics
    • BERNSTEIN, L. 1996. Better software through operational dynamics. IEEE Softw. 13, 2, 107-109.
    • (1996) IEEE Softw. , vol.13 , Issue.2 , pp. 107-109
    • Bernstein, L.1
  • 9
    • 33646516363 scopus 로고    scopus 로고
    • Certifying software component attributes
    • BOEGH, J. 2006. Certifying software component attributes. IEEE Softw. 23, 74-81.
    • (2006) IEEE Softw. , vol.23 , pp. 74-81
    • Boegh, J.1
  • 21
    • 84943730764 scopus 로고
    • Hardware-software cosynthesis for microcontrollers
    • ERNST, R. AND HENKEL, J. 1993. Hardware-Software cosynthesis for microcontrollers. IEEE Des. Test Comput. 10, 64-74.
    • (1993) IEEE Des. Test Comput. , vol.10 , pp. 64-74
    • Ernst, R.1    Henkel, J.2
  • 29
    • 35348948444 scopus 로고    scopus 로고
    • Self-reconfigurable embedded systems on low-cost FPGAs
    • GONZALEZ, I., AGUAYO, E., AND LOPEZ-BUEDO, S. 2007. Self-Reconfigurable embedded systems on low-cost FPGAs. IEEE Micro, 49-57.
    • (2007) IEEE Micro , pp. 49-57
    • Gonzalez, I.1    Aguayo, E.2    Lopez-Buedo, S.3
  • 31
    • 0001858873 scopus 로고
    • Hardware-software cosynthesis for digital systems
    • GUPTA, R. K. AND MICHELI, G. D. 1993. Hardware-Software cosynthesis for digital systems. IEEE Des. Test Comput., 29-41.
    • (1993) IEEE Des. Test Comput. , pp. 29-41
    • Gupta, R.K.1    Micheli, G.D.2
  • 37
    • 0035300993 scopus 로고    scopus 로고
    • An approach to automated hardware/software partitioning using a flexible granularity that is driven by high-level estimation techniques
    • HENKEL, J. AND ERNST, R. 2001. An approach to automated hardware/software partitioning using a flexible granularity that is driven by high-level estimation techniques. IEEE Trans. VLSI Syst. 9, 2, 273-289.
    • (2001) IEEE Trans. VLSI Syst. , vol.9 , Issue.2 , pp. 273-289
    • Henkel, J.1    Ernst, R.2
  • 38
    • 34548258236 scopus 로고    scopus 로고
    • A framework for heterogeneous specification and design of electronic embedded systems in systemc
    • HERRERA, F. AND VILLAR, E. 2007. A framework for heterogeneous specification and design of electronic embedded systems in systemc. ACM Trans. Des. Autom. Electron. Syst. 12, 3.
    • (2007) ACM Trans. Des. Autom. Electron. Syst. , vol.12 , pp. 3
    • Herrera, F.1    Villar, E.2
  • 39
    • 49049114221 scopus 로고    scopus 로고
    • Conquering complexity
    • HOLZMANN, G. J. 2007. Conquering complexity. IEEE Comput. 40, 12.
    • (2007) IEEE Comput. , vol.40 , pp. 12
    • Holzmann, G.J.1
  • 40
    • 15044358802 scopus 로고    scopus 로고
    • Hardware/software interface codesign for embedded systems
    • JERRAYA, A. A. AND WOLF, W. 2005. Hardware/software interface codesign for embedded systems. IEEE Comput. 38, 2, 63-69.
    • (2005) IEEE Comput. , vol.38 , Issue.2 , pp. 63-69
    • Jerraya, A.A.1    Wolf, W.2
  • 41
    • 77953566541 scopus 로고    scopus 로고
    • KALAVADE, A. 1995. Ph.D. Dissertation. Ph.D. thesis, University of California, Berkeley
    • KALAVADE, A. 1995. Ph.D. Dissertation. Ph.D. thesis, University of California, Berkeley.
  • 45
    • 33751012386 scopus 로고    scopus 로고
    • The maintenance and evolution of resource-constrained embedded systems created using design patterns
    • KURIAN, S. AND PONT, M. J. 2006. The maintenance and evolution of resource-constrained embedded systems created using design patterns. The J. Syst. Softw, 80, 1, 32-41.
    • (2006) The J. Syst. Softw , vol.80 , Issue.1 , pp. 32-41
    • Kurian, S.1    Pont, M.J.2
  • 47
    • 0034273528 scopus 로고    scopus 로고
    • What's ahead for embedded software?
    • LEE, E. A. 2000. What's ahead for embedded software? IEEE Comput. 18-26.
    • (2000) IEEE Comput. , pp. 18-26
    • Lee, E.A.1
  • 50
    • 0042244291 scopus 로고    scopus 로고
    • On the hardware-software partitioning problem: System modeling and partitioning techniques
    • LOPEZ-VALLEJO, M. AND LOPEZ, J. C. 2003. On the hardware-software partitioning problem: System modeling and partitioning techniques. ACM Trans. Des. Autom. Electron. Syst. 8, 3, 269-297.
    • (2003) ACM Trans. Des. Autom. Electron. Syst. , vol.8 , Issue.3 , pp. 269-297
    • Lopez-Vallejo, M.1    Lopez, J.C.2
  • 51
    • 52549086188 scopus 로고    scopus 로고
    • Scalability and parallel execution of warp processing - Dynamic hardware/ software partitioning
    • LYSECKY, R. 2008. Scalability and parallel execution of warp processing - Dynamic hardware/software partitioning. Int. J. Parall. Program 36, 5, 478-492.
    • (2008) Int. J. Parall. Program , vol.36 , Issue.5 , pp. 478-492
    • Lysecky, R.1
  • 53
    • 33748437678 scopus 로고    scopus 로고
    • Computation and communication refinement for multiprocessor SoC design: A system level perspective
    • MARCULESCU, R., OGRAS, U. Y., AND ZAMORA, N. H. 2006. Computation and communication refinement for multiprocessor SoC design: A system level perspective. ACM Trans. Des. Autom. Electron. Syst. 11, 3.
    • (2006) ACM Trans. Des. Autom. Electron. Syst. , vol.11 , pp. 3
    • Marculescu, R.1    Ogras, U.Y.2    Zamora, N.H.3
  • 54
    • 33747041013 scopus 로고    scopus 로고
    • A survey of embedded systems' programming languages
    • MAURER, S. S. 2002. A survey of embedded systems' programming languages. IEEE Potentials 21.
    • (2002) IEEE Potentials , vol.21
    • Maurer, S.S.1
  • 55
    • 0029325224 scopus 로고
    • Reusing software: Issues and research directions
    • MILI, H., MILI, F., AND MILI, A. 1995. Reusing software: Issues and research directions. IEEE Trans. Softw. Engin. 21, 6.
    • (1995) IEEE Trans. Softw. Engin. , vol.21 , pp. 6
    • Mili, H.1    Mili, F.2    Mili, A.3
  • 56
    • 77953591436 scopus 로고    scopus 로고
    • (1/8)
    • MINDLESS. (1/08). http://www.lysator.liu.se/mbrx/mindless/.
  • 59
    • 33747156640 scopus 로고    scopus 로고
    • Changing the paradigm of software engineering
    • RAJLICH, V. 2006. Changing the paradigm of software engineering. Comm. ACM 49, 8.
    • (2006) Comm. ACM , vol.49 , pp. 8
    • Rajlich, V.1
  • 61
    • 3242667249 scopus 로고    scopus 로고
    • Incremental change in object-oriented programming
    • RAJLICH, V. AND GOSAVI, P. 2004. Incremental change in object-oriented programming. IEEE Comput.
    • (2004) IEEE Comput.
    • Rajlich, V.1    Gosavi, P.2
  • 62
    • 36248967018 scopus 로고    scopus 로고
    • Software-defined radio prospects for multistandard mobile phones
    • RAMACHER, U. 2007. Software-Defined radio prospects for multistandard mobile phones. IEEE Comput. 40.
    • (2007) IEEE Comput. , vol.40
    • Ramacher, U.1
  • 63
    • 77953600513 scopus 로고    scopus 로고
    • Bugs check out, but they don't check
    • REPORT
    • REPORT. 2005. Bugs check out, but they don't check in. Linux Mag.
    • (2005) Linux Mag
  • 64
    • 0041848570 scopus 로고    scopus 로고
    • Electronic-system design in the automobile industry
    • SANGIOVANNI-VINCENTELLI, A. 2003. Electronic-System design in the automobile industry. IEEE Micro 23, 3.
    • (2003) IEEE Micro , vol.23 , pp. 3
    • Sangiovanni-Vincentelli, A.1
  • 65
  • 68
    • 77953559003 scopus 로고    scopus 로고
    • 1/08
    • SPECC. http://www.specc.gr.jp/eng/index.html. (1/08).
  • 73
    • 85013441915 scopus 로고    scopus 로고
    • Energy savings and speedups from partitioning critical software loops to hardware in embedded systems
    • STITT, G., VAHID, F., AND NEMATBAKHSH, S. 2004. Energy savings and speedups from partitioning critical software loops to hardware in embedded systems. ACM Trans. Embed. Comput. Syst. 3,1, 218-232.
    • (2004) ACM Trans. Embed. Comput. Syst. , vol.3 , Issue.1 , pp. 218-232
    • Stitt, G.1    Vahid, F.2    Nematbakhsh, S.3
  • 74
    • 77953591133 scopus 로고    scopus 로고
    • 1/08
    • SYSTEMC. http://www.systemc.org/home. (1/08).
  • 77
    • 0033901302 scopus 로고    scopus 로고
    • The Koala component model for consumer electronics software
    • VAN OMMERING, R. AND VAN DE LINDEN, F. 2000. The Koala component model for consumer electronics software. IEEE Comput. 78-85.
    • (2000) IEEE Comput. , pp. 78-85
    • Van Ommering, R.1    Van De Linden, F.2
  • 80
  • 81
    • 0344089201 scopus 로고    scopus 로고
    • A decade of hardware/software codesign
    • WOLF, W. 2003. A decade of hardware/software codesign. IEEE Comput. 36, 4, 38-43.
    • (2003) IEEE Comput. , vol.36 , Issue.4 , pp. 38-43
    • Wolf, W.1


* 이 정보는 Elsevier사의 SCOPUS DB에서 KISTI가 분석하여 추출한 것입니다.